Welcome to the Website of the Chemical and Process Engineering Institute. The research activities of the Institute cover a wide range of topics in chemical engineering. It serves many branches of the chemical and food industries with its expertise. Since environment pollution is a big problem in Poland, we have also started a research programme into environment protection. The Institute offers full time courses in chemical engineering leading to MSc Eng. degrees. The main research fields of the Chemical Engineering Group include: chemical reactors engineering, hydrodynamics of multiphase systems, mass transfer processes (especially absorption), adsorption and extraction and heat transfer in multiphase systems. Our applied research programs focus on the design of new tower packing, optimisation of heat exchanger systems, design of flue gas desulphurisation systems and effluent treatment. The research interests of the Physical Chemistry Group focus on various aspects of solid-state chemistry and catalysis, and transition metal co-ordination chemistry. International co-operation: Technical Universities in Berlin, Munchen and Karlsruhe, Mining Academy in Freiberg (Germany), Russian Academy of Science-Moscow, Chemical - Technological Academy in Ivanovo (Russia) and Ecole Centrale de Lille (France).
